BC414 Explained: How to Efficiently Program Database Updates
Database updates are the lifeblood of any kind of durable application. They ensure that your information remains accurate, appropriate, and enhanced for efficiency. But let's face it: updating a database can be an overwhelming task. It's not almost entering brand-new details; it involves careful preparation and execution to prevent risks that could cause severe issues down the line.If you're in London and aiming to raise your skills around, you could have come across BC414-- Programming Database Updates program london. This course focuses on outfitting developers with the expertise they require to tackle database updates successfully and effectively.Whether you're a seasoned developer or just starting, recognizing just how to browse the intricacies of database updates is critical for your success. Allow's dive deeper into what makes these procedures testing and check out some devices and strategies that can help simplify them! Recognizing Database Updates Database updates are crucial for preserving the honesty of your information. They encompass a variety of tasks, varying from
placing new documents to modifying existing info. Each update carries considerable implications for application efficiency and customer experience.At its core, a reliable database upgrade needs a clear understanding of the underlying framework. This consists of recognizing how tables associate with each other and recognizing the constraints that regulate information access. Moreover, it's vital to think about transaction administration during updates. Making sure that modifications are atomic ways either all modifications take place or none do-- this helps secure against partial updates that can corrupt your dataset.As systems grow more facility, so does the demand for mindful planning in performing these updates. Being proactive can conserve time and resources while improving total system reliability as you browse with evolving company needs.
Typical Challenges in Database Updates Data source updates can typically feel like navigating a minefield. One typical challenge is making sure information integrity. When numerous individuals attempt to upgrade the exact same record, conflicts emerge, causing prospective loss of crucial information.Another issue is downtime throughout updates. Services depend
on real-time information gain access to, and any type of interruption can interrupt operations. Striking a balance in between needed updates and preserving accessibility is essential.Moreover, compatibility issues with existing systems frequently surface. New software or database versions may not straighten completely with older applications, complicating the update process.Security vulnerabilities additionally position substantial threats throughout data source modifications. Every upgrade opens doors that could be exploited otherwise handled very carefully. Ensuring robust security procedures are in place aids mitigate these dangers while keeping information safe.Insufficient documents typically causes confusion amongst staff member when carrying out updates. Clear guidelines can reduce misunderstandings and simplify processes for
everybody entailed. Tools and Techniques for Streamlining Database Updates When it concerns simplifying database updates, having the right devices and methods is crucial. Automation can conserve a great deal of time. Devices like SQL manuscripts allow for hop over to these guys set processing, enabling you to carry out
many updates quickly.Using version control systems aids track adjustments effectively. In this manner, you make certain that every upgrade is recorded and relatively easy to fix if needed. Code review techniques additionally play a substantial role in maintaining